Process for the Production of Hot Melt Adhesives Having a Low Emission of Monomeric Isocyanates
The present invention refers to a process for the production of hot melt adhesives having a low emission of monomeric isocyanates upon heating wherein in a first step a polyurethane prepolymer is generated which is subsequently reacted with a chain extender. Further, the present invention refers to hot melt adhesives obtained by the inventive process.
Aromatic polyester polyether polyurethane panels and useful materials comprising same
This abstract is intended as a scanning tool for purposes of searching in the particular art and is not intended to be limiting of the present disclosure. The disclosure provides aromatic polyester polyether polyols and compositions comprising such polyols. The disclosed aromatic polyester polyether polyols and compositions including same are the products of the transesterification reaction of polyethylene terephthalate (“PET”) and an ethoxylated triol, namely glycerin or trimethylolpropane, wherein the degree of ethoxylation is from 1 to 9 moles. At least some of the PET used to generate the aromatic polyester polyether polyols is derived from recycled PET. The disclosed aromatic polyester polyether polyols have utility in preparing polyurethane materials, for example.
Semi-crystalline mixture of polyester polyols, and the use thereof
The present invention relates to a semi-crystalline mixture of polyester polyols which recrystallises upon melting and which can be obtained by polycondensing a reaction mixture comprising one or more dicarboxylic acids selected from saturated aliphatic dicarboxylic acids having an even number of at least 8 methylene groups, and one or more diols selected from aliphatic diols which have at least one ether function. The invention also relates to a polymeric material which is obtained from the chemical modification of the mixture of polyester polyols with organic compounds which contain at least one isocyonate group and/or epoxide group. The mixtures and materials according to the invention are characterised by relatively low melting enthalpies, while the melting temperature can be set in a range of −30 to 60° C., meaning that it is possible to obtain easily fusible formulations containing the mixtures and materials according to the invention. The mixtures and materials according to the invention also provide such formulations with a high elasticity and breaking resistance. The present invention therefore includes the use of the polyester polyols and polymeric materials according to the invention as deforming, fusing, and extrusion means in thermoplastic materials, and the use thereof for producing adhesives and sealants, in particular hot-melt adhesives and reactive adhesives.

FLEXIBILIZED POLYURETHANES FOR FLEXIBLE PACKAGING ADHESIVE WITHOUT AROMATIC AMINE MIGRATION
Provided is an adhesive comprising a reaction product of (A1) an aliphatic isocyanate having an NCO group content of 18 to 64 and (A2) a polyol or polyamine having a molecular weight of from 400 to 4000; and (B) a polyaspartate compound, wherein viscosity of the adhesive, as measured @ 23° C. according to ASTM D4212-16, remains below 60 seconds for after four hours, and wherein the adhesive develops an acceptable bond strength to a substrate, defined as having a minimum of 150 g/in. measured @ 23° C. according to ASTM D 1876-01 or substrate tear, in less than or equal to five days after the substrate is laminated with the adhesive. The adhesives are free of aromatic amines and may find use in multi-layered laminated films for the production of flexible packaging useful in a variety of industries, including the food processing, cosmetics, and detergents industries.
Thermoplastic polyurethanes with high moisture vapor transmission and low water absorption
A novel thermoplastic polyurethane composition is disclosed which comprise the reaction product of a polyisocyanate component, a polyol component, wherein the polyol component comprises a polyester comprising the reaction product of triethylene glycol and/or tetraethylene glycol with a diacid having 6 carbon atoms or fewer, and, optionally, a chain extender component.
LOW FREE POLYURETHANE PREPOLYMER COMPOSITION FOR REACTIVE HOT MELT ADHESIVES
The present invention relates to a reactive polyurethane prepolymer composition, which can be used as a hot melt adhesive, comprising a first polyurethane prepolymer which is the reaction product of the reaction of methylene diphenyl diisocyanate (MDI) with poly(1,6-hexamethylene adipate) glycol (PHAG) with a molecular weight (Mw) of 500 g/mol to 10,000 g/mol and with an NCO content of 0.5 wt % to 7 wt %, preferably of 3 wt % to 7 wt % and more preferably of 5 wt % to 7 wt %, comprising less than 0.1 wt % free MDI monomer based on the total weight of the first polyurethane prepolymer, a second polyurethane prepolymer which is the reaction product of the reaction of methylene diphenyl diisocyanate with polypropylene glycol (PPG) or a succinic acid based polyester polyol with a molecular weight (Mw) of 250 g/mol to 4,000 g/mol and with an NCO content of 0.5 wt % to 12 wt %, preferably of 3 wt % to 11 wt % and more preferably of 5 wt % to 10 wt %, comprising less than 0.1 wt % free MDI monomer based on the total weight of the second polyurethane prepolymer, and optionally one or more catalysts, as well as a process for producing said reactive polyurethane prepolymer composition, a method for adhesively joining or sealing two substrates and the use as an hot melt adhesive.
ADDITIVE FOR TEMPERATURE ADAPTIVE RHEOLOGY PROFILE
The invention relates to a polymer (P) comprising at least one segment (S1) and at least one segment (S2) covalently linked to each other, wherein i) at least one segment (S1) has a number average molecular weight in the range of 6,000-25,000 g/mol and consists of ether repeating units, and for at least 75% by weight of repeating units of the formula —[CH.sub.2—CH.sub.2—O—]—, ii) at least one segment (S2) has a number average molecular weight of at most 10,000 g/mol and consists of ether repeating units, and for at most 25% by weight of repeating units of the formula —[CH.sub.2—CH.sub.2—O—]—, iii) polymer (P) comprises terminal groups comprising at least one of hydroxyl, primary amine or salts thereof, secondary amine or salts thereof, carboxylic acid or salts thereof.
Composition for holographic recording medium, cured product for holographic recording medium, and holographic recording medium
A holographic recording medium composition contains an isocyanate group-containing compound (component (a-1)), an isocyanate-reactive functional group-containing compound (component (b-1)), a polymerizable monomer (component (c-1)), a photopolymerization initiator (component (d-1)), and a stable nitroxyl radical group-containing compound (component (e-1)). A ratio of the total weight of a propylene glycol unit and a tetramethylene glycol unit that are contained in the component (b-1) to the total weight of the component (a-1) and the component (b-1) is 30% or less.
POLYURETHANE COMPOSITIONS, PRODUCTS PREPARED WITH SAME AND PREPARATION METHODS THEREOF
A polyurethane composition is provided. The polyurethane composition comprises (A) one or more polyurethane-prepolymers prepared by reacting at least one polyisocyanate compound with a first polyol component; and (B) a second polyol component; wherein at least one of the first polyol component and the second polyol component comprises an ester/ether block copolymer polyol synthesized by reacting a starting material polyether polyol with a C.sub.4-C.sub.20 lactone. The polyurethane foam prepared by using the polyurethane composition can achieve inhibited internal heat buildup, high thermal stability and superior tear strength. A polyurethane product prepared with said foam, a method for preparing the polyurethane foam and a method for improving the performance property of the polyurethane foam are also provided.
